  SmartSMS 5.0 GSMsoft  

SmartSMS  

Rating: 4.29/5 (7 votes)


Released: Feb 24, 2002

Platforms:

Win95 Win98 WinME WinXP WinNT4.x Windows2000

SmartSMS enables you to send Picture Messages, Caller Group Graphic, Operator Logo, Ringtones and FlashSMS. Picturemessages can be sent to Nokia AND EMS compatible phones (new handsets by Ericsson, Siemens, Alcatel, Motorola) FlashSMS is supported by almost ALL of the newer phones from Nokia, Philips, NEC, Siemens, Ericsson, Alcatel, Motorola and Sagem. Ringtones can now be sent to Nokia, Ericsson, Motorola, Sagem and EMS compatible phones. Caller Group Graphics and Operator Logos are supported by Nokia phones only. To send the SMS, SmartSMS can use, - Modem (dial-up direct to an operator that support the UCP protocol) or - Phone or GSM modem connected to your PC through cable/IR/Bluetooth (NEW) or - Internet (TCP/IP) New gateway added with the lowest messages rate (from $ 0.043 per messages, that is ONLY $4.3 per 100 messages)
